Today, the America First Policy Institute released a statement from Brett Tolman, Chair of Law and Justice, addressing the current government shutdown. Tolman criticized Congress for prioritizing healthcare for undocumented immigrants over the pay of National Guard members.
"As radicals in Congress keep the government shutdown, the brave men and women of the National Guard are being unjustly denied immediate pay," said Tolman. He emphasized that these service members are crucial in maintaining public safety in Washington D.C., Los Angeles, and Memphis. Their efforts have reportedly led to a reduction in violent crime in these cities.
Tolman argued that Congress is "holding the government hostage" to advocate for taxpayer-funded healthcare for illegal aliens instead of compensating those who protect Americans. He called on Washington to prioritize those defending the nation and urged an end to the shutdown.
The America First Policy Institute is urging respect for Guardsmen who prioritize American safety and security.
